Code

Rating   Name Duplication Size Complexity CRAP Changes Bugs Features
B LaravelServiceProvider::getSettingsData() 0 54 9 9 0 0 0
A CorsIlluminate\CorsMiddleware::handle() 0 30 5 5 0 0 0
A LaravelServiceProvider::getCreateAnalyzerClosure() 0 18 2 2 0 0 0
A CorsIlluminate\Settings\Settings::getData() 0 11 1 2 0 0 0
A CorsMiddleware::getPrepareCorsHeaders() 0 9 2 2 0 0 0
A LaravelServiceProvider::getCreateAnalysisStrategyClosure() 0 9 1 1 0 0 0
A CorsIlluminate\Settings\Settings::setData() 0 9 2 6 0 0 0
A LaravelServiceProvider::mergeConfigs() 0 8 1 1 0 0 0
A IlluminateRequestToPsr7::withoutHeader() 0 4 1 1 0 0 0
A CorsMiddleware::getCorsAnalysis() 0 7 1 1 0 0 0
A Settings\Settings::isLogEnabled() 0 4 1 2 0 0 0
A IlluminateRequestToPsr7::withProtocolVersion() 0 4 1 1 0 0 0
A IlluminateRequestToPsr7::__construct() 0 4 1 1 0 0 0
A IlluminateRequestToPsr7::getUri() 0 4 1 1 0 0 0
A LaravelServiceProvider::registerPublishConfig() 0 7 1 1 0 0 0